HD Graphics 610 | vs | GeForce RTX 2080 Ti |
---|---|---|
Aug 30th, 2016 | Release Date | Sep 20th, 2018 |
HD Graphics-M | Generation | GeForce 20 |
Not Available | MSRP | $999 |
Portable Device Dependent | Outputs | 1x HDMI, 3x DisplayPort, 1x USB Type-C |
None | Power Connectors | 2x 8-pin |
Integrated | Segment | Desktop |
System-Shared | Memory | 11 GB |
System-Shared | Type | GDDR6 |
System-Shared | Bus | 352-bit |
System-Shared | Bandwidth | 616 GB/s |
300 MHz | Base Clock Speed | 1350 MHz |
900 MHz | Boost Clock Speed | 1545 MHz |
System-Shared | Memory Clock Speed | 1750 MHz |
